Speaking at a BCP regional congress in Mogoditshane, Gobotswang said the members have consistently failed to respond to issues of national concern like the examination crisis where teachers are refusing to invigilate after failing to agree on remuneration with the Botswana Examinations Council (BEC).
"This is a scandal of a magnitude that I have never seen since I was born. You will realise that most of the students at these schools are the children of the poor. Their lives are in danger. If we can't protect the poor, students at tertiary, secondary schools and fire-fighters who perish fighting fires, what are we doing? You are sitting idle," he said.
